About This Property

Property Id: 23926 Spacious 3-4 bedroom, 2 bath home on a quiet cul-de-sac in family-friendly neighborhood, this charming cape-style home abuts the Amethyst Brook Conservation area with 30 miles of trails. First floor has an open floor plan. Dining/living area with propane fireplace opens to an updated chef's kitchen including 2 stainless steel sinks, silestone quartz counters & island, custom cabinetry, and a stainless steel double oven, cooktop & fridge. Large first floor bedroom runs the width of the house, and first floor also has a full bath. Second floor has two nice sized bedrooms w/ ceiling fans, and a full bath with solar powered skylight. Wood flooring throughout home. Finished basement includes a large living area/playroom with sliding glass walk out & large window overlooking the conservation area, a 4th bedroom/office, and a laundry room with washer & dryer. House is heated with propane fireplace and electric baseboard heat that can be adjusted room to room with programmable thermostats.

City - Amherst

Academia is not in short supply in Amherst. The town, also nicknamed “Knowledge Corridor,” houses three out of five institutions of the Five College Consortium, including Amherst College, Hampshire College, and the University of Massachusetts Amherst. So they really know their stuff here!

Much like the campuses, the city’s downtown area is vibrant and encompassed by a cinema, coffeehouses, diverse restaurants, and bookstores. Amherst Town Common is a large green space along North Pleasant Street, an ideal location for a pick-up Frisbee game or relaxing with a favorite novel under an oak tree. This college town has it all including Emily Dickinson’s childhood home, which is now a museum dedicated to the famous poet and her family.

Being immersed in culture is what makes Amherst a great city. Many conservations are located here, so the area is naturally beautiful year-round. In addition to Hampshire Mall and Interstate 91, locals want you to know how to say the city’s name correctly.
